Key Points

  • Tencent Music MAU down 2800万;汽水音乐 up 90% in 3 years
  • AI music production: 300元 vs 1-2万 human, uploads surge 40% on Deezer
  • 86%汽水热歌 from抖音, prioritizing distribution over artist IP
  • Shift: finite creators to infinite AI content, value in algorithms
  • Tencent clings to 'human quality' but ignores AI+algo efficiency

🔑 Enhanced Key Takeaways

  • Tencent Music's paying users increased 5.3% year-on-year to 127.4 million in Q4 2025, despite the MAU decline.[1][2]
  • Average revenue per paying user (ARPPU) rose 7.2% to 11.9 yuan in Q4 2025, driven by premium services like Dolby Atmos enhancements on over 300 classic tracks.[1][2]
  • Tencent Music enlisted celebrities Ding Yuxi, Ju Jingyi, and Wang Junkai as brand ambassadors to offer Super Members priority access to events like the QQ Music 2026 Super Summit Night.[1][2]

🔮 Future ImplicationsAI analysis grounded in cited sources

Tencent Music's profit growth will continue if ARPPU rises exceed MAU declines
Q4 2025 data shows paying users and ARPPU increased despite MAU drop, indicating a shift to higher per-user value in a mature market.[1][2]
Short-video platforms will further erode music MAU unless Tencent integrates more deeply
Management attributes the 5% MAU decline to competition from Douyin and Kuaishou, which continue capturing entertainment time.[1][2][5]
